FURAZOL PEDIATRIC SUSPENSION

Composition
Paediatric Suspension
Tablet
(5 ml)
Metronidazole 200 mg 200 mg
Diloxanide furoate 100 mg 250 mg

Properties and Mode of Action


FURAZOL combines the complementary actions of two well-established drugs, diloxanide furoate, the luminal amoebicide
and metronidazole, the potent tissue amoebicide.
Both, acting synergistically and rapidly, produce high parasitological and clinical cure rates.
Diloxanide furoate and metronidazole, as well as treating intestinal amoebiasis, clear amoebic cysts from the intestine and
cure liver abscess with no relapses.
FURAZOL is well-tolerated and provides comprehensive treatment for both intestinal and extra-intestinal amoebiasis
independent of additional drugs.

Indications
Acute intestinal amoebiasis.
Chronic intestinal amoebiasis.
Extra-intestinal amoebiasis.
Giardiasis.

Dosage and Administration


Adults: 2 tablets 3 times daily for 5 - 10 days.
Children 2 - 5 years: 1/2 - 1 teaspoonful 3 times daily for 5 - 10 days.
Children 6 - 10 years: 1 1/2 - 2 teaspoonfuls 3 times daily for 5 - 10 days.
Children 11 - 12 years: 1 1/2 dessertspoonful 3 times daily for 5 - 10 days.

Contra_indications
Though there is no absolute contraindication to the use of FURAZOL, it is still preferably avoided in pregnancy.

Side effects
Side effects withFURAZOL is usually well-tolerated but flatulence and mild gastric upset may occur in hypersensitive
individuals.
Metallic taste or darkening of urine may also occur.

Presentation
FURAZOL Suspension for Paediatrics : Bottle of 100 ml.
FURAZOL Tablets : Box of 2 blisters of 10 scored tablets each.
